0028949: BRepOffsetAPI_MakePipe Generated() method produces no result for spine edges
[occt.git] / tests / bugs / modalg_7 / bug28949_7
1 puts "============"
2 puts "OCC28949"
3 puts "============"
4 puts ""
5 ##############################################################################
6 # BRepOffsetAPI_MakePipe Generated() method produces no result for spine edges
7 ##############################################################################
8
9 restore [locate_data_file bug29204_sweep_spine.brep] sp
10 restore [locate_data_file bug29204_sweep_profile.brep] pr
11
12 mksweep sp
13 addsweep pr
14 buildsweep q -C -S
15
16 explode sp
17
18 savehistory sweep_hist
19
20 generated r1 sweep_hist sp_1
21 generated r2 sweep_hist sp_2
22 generated r3 sweep_hist sp_3
23 generated r4 sweep_hist sp_4
24 generated r5 sweep_hist sp_5
25 generated r6 sweep_hist sp_6
26 generated r7 sweep_hist sp_7
27
28 checknbshapes r1 -face 4
29 checknbshapes r2 -face 4
30 checknbshapes r3 -face 4
31 checknbshapes r4 -face 4
32 checknbshapes r5 -face 4
33 checknbshapes r6 -face 4
34 checknbshapes r7 -face 4
35
36 explode sp v
37
38 generated r1 sweep_hist sp_1
39 generated r2 sweep_hist sp_2
40 generated r3 sweep_hist sp_3
41 generated r4 sweep_hist sp_4
42 generated r5 sweep_hist sp_5
43 generated r6 sweep_hist sp_6
44 generated r7 sweep_hist sp_7
45
46 checkprops r1 -l 147.629
47 checkprops r2 -l 160.296
48 checkprops r3 -l 160.296
49 checkprops r4 -l 147.629
50 checkprops r5 -l 147.629
51 checkprops r6 -l 180.945
52 checkprops r7 -l 180.945